Datawaves is an open-source data analysis and visualization platform optimized for exploring large, complex datasets. It provides a suite of tools for data ingestion, cleaning, transformation, statistical analysis, machine learning, and interactive visualization.
Key features of Datawaves include:
Datawaves provides Python, R, and SQL interfaces for analysis, giving users flexibility. It can handle structured, semi-structured, temporal, geospatial, and other complex data types. The platform enables users to go from raw data to meaningful insights quickly through a user-friendly graphical interface.
